S.N.M. Abdi

S.N.M. Abdi

Editor

  • Not So Fast

    Will India and Bangladesh quickly sign the Teesta River water-sharing agreement now that Mamata Banerjee has publicly pledged to stand by the central government in external affairs matters?

    BY S.N.M. Abdi 27 March 2013

    Not So Fast

Advertisement

Advertisement